Sued and Screwed


What a week it has been for University of Kentucky's Athletic Director Mitch Barnhardt. In the same week reports of the University being Sued by their former coach, and reports that their new coach is under heavy investigation by the NCAA have all surfaced.

On the brink of having the Number 1 recruiting class in the nation the wildcats still can't seem to get rid of the dark cloud hovering around its basketball program, with Billy Clyde still showing his face around town all the while preparing to drop the six million dollar hammer on the University for payment he feels he is still owed.

But the scrutiny doesn't stop there, UK's new Savior has been brought to the forefront of a NCAA investigation of Memphis University's basketball program, where there has been reports of tampering with a SAT score of a former Memphis player who many are saying may be NBA Rookie of the year Derrick Rose.

I guess by now coach Cal. is getting pretty used to having his victories contested, with the 'disappearance' of his UMass final four, and now with the risk of losing his Memphis championship run, all that is left is for the floor to fall in on the CALIPARTY, before the music even starts to play.

BYE BYE BILLY CLYDE


The University of Kentucky has released a statement that Billy Gillispie is out as coach of the Wildcats after two seasons. A highly speculated move finally has come to fruition and the whirlwind of rumors of who is to be the next coach of Kentucky will swirl at a feverish pace. There is a press conference to take place at 4:30 PM today to formally announce the decision. Fair Warning....





Again, YDF has been notified by a number of credible sources in and around the University of Kentucky athletic department that Billy Gillispie will be fired before the end of the week. That being the case, Kentucky has to have someone with superior credentials of Billy Clyde's on board to make this tough decision. That being said, there are about 3 coaches that come to mind: Billy Donovan, Jay Wright, or John Calipari. Of course, if Memphis and Villanova make it to the Final Four that will make it more difficult for Kentucky to have serious contact with them. But from the roars we're hearing in Lexington, Cats fans would love any of the three on the sidelines next season. We're told to be expecting the news to hit papers around friday morning.
